Category-wise expected cutoff (indicative)
| Category | Expected Cutoff (indicative) |
|---|---|
| General | 580-680/700 (83-97%) |
| EWS | 560-660/700 (80-94%) |
| OBC-NCL | 540-640/700 (77-91%) |
| SC | 480-580/700 (69-83%) |
| ST | 450-550/700 (64-79%) |
| PwD | 420-520/700 (60-74%) |
- Typical category differentials: General-to-OBC gap is ~40-50 marks (5-7%); OBC-to-SC gap is ~60-80 marks (8-11%); SC-to-ST gap is ~30-40 marks (4-6%). PwD cutoffs track 20-30 marks below corresponding general category benchmarks.
- Cutoff drivers: Premier DU colleges (LSR, St. Stephen's, Hindu, SRCC) push General cutoffs to 95-97% range; domain-specific programs (Economics, CS, Psychology) demand 3-5% higher than general humanities. Domain test performance + CUET marks composite determines final merit.
- Year-on-year variation: Cutoffs fluctuate 2-4% based on paper difficulty, number of test-takers (2.5M+ in recent cycles), and seat matrix changes. Normalization across multiple sessions can compress or expand score distributions significantly.

Top 1% — most competitive programs
97–100%rank ~1–3,000
- Delhi University — BA honors in premier colleges for Economics, Political Science, English (St. Stephen's, Hindu College — approximate cut-off 98-99th percentile)
- Jawaharlal Nehru University — BA honors in most sought-after programs (approximate cut-off 97-99th percentile)
- Delhi University — B.Sc honors Mathematics, Physics, Chemistry in top colleges (approximate cut-off 98th percentile)
- Jamia Millia Islamia — highly competitive programs like Mass Communication, BA English honors (approximate cut-off 97-98th percentile)
- Banaras Hindu University — BA/B.Sc honors in flagship programs with General category reservation
Elite programs — top colleges
92–97%rank ~3,000–15,000
- Delhi University — BA honors in top colleges like St. Stephen's, Hindu, Miranda House (approximate cut-off 93-95th percentile for competitive courses)
- Jawaharlal Nehru University — BA honors Economics, Political Science (approximate cut-off 94th percentile)
- Banaras Hindu University — BA honors Economics, English (approximate cut-off 92-94th percentile)
- Jamia Millia Islamia — Mass Communication, BA honors English (approximate cut-off 93rd percentile)
- University of Hyderabad — integrated MA programs in select disciplines
Top central universities — general programs
85–92%rank ~15,000–50,000
- Delhi University — BA Program in affiliated colleges (approximate cut-off 87-90th percentile for mid-tier colleges)
- Jawaharlal Nehru University — BA in languages, social sciences (non-honors, approximate cut-off 88th percentile)
- Banaras Hindu University — BA honors in humanities (approximate cut-off 86-88th percentile)
- Jamia Millia Islamia — B.A. honors programs in competitive subjects
- University of Hyderabad — BA/B.Sc programs in various disciplines
Tier 2 central universities
75–85%rank ~50,000–1,50,000
- Jamia Millia Islamia — BA Program, B.Com (approximate cut-off 78-82nd percentile for general courses)
- Central University of South Bihar — BA/B.Sc with better subject combinations
- Banaras Hindu University — B.Sc in non-medical streams (approximate cut-off 80th percentile)
- Aligarh Muslim University — BA/B.Com in competitive streams
- Pondicherry University — B.Sc honors programs (main campus)
- University of Hyderabad — integrated programs in some disciplines
Mid-tier central universities
60–75%rank ~1,50,000–4,00,000
- Central University of Kerala — BA English, History (approximate cut-off 65th percentile)
- Central University of Gujarat — B.Com, BBA programs
- Central University of Tamil Nadu — B.Sc courses in Biology, Chemistry
- Tripura University — BA/B.Sc general programs
- Mizoram University — various UG programs in humanities and sciences
- Some competitive programs at newer central universities
Tier 3 universities range
40–60%rank ~4,00,000–8,00,000
- Central University of Haryana — BA/B.Com programs (approximate cut-off 50-60th percentile)
- Central University of Rajasthan — B.Sc general courses
- Pondicherry University — BA in non-competitive streams (Karaikal campus)
- Some state central universities in less competitive programs
- Private participating universities with moderate selectivity
Below typical cut-offs
0–40%
- Unlikely to secure admission in participating central universities this cycle
- May qualify for some state university programs with lower cut-offs
- Consider private university options or reappear next cycle
- Focus on strengthening domain subjects and general test sections
